Text Box: The origin of Taiji Quan is obscure. 
One story is of Wang Tsung-yueh who was passing through Chen Jia Gou. After a conversation with the villagers, many challenged him to combat. Using his soft ‘internal’ style against their hard ‘external’ style, he beat them all. Impressed by his skill the Chen family invited him to teach them his skill.
An alternative version prefered by the Chen family is that a family member, Chen Wangting (1597-1664), created Taiji Quan.  The style was handed down within the family until the arrival of Yang Luchan.
One belief is that it was developed by an immortal named Chang San-Feng in the 16th Century. He was living as a hermit on Wudang Mountain and passed his art onto Chang Sung-Qi. Some believe that this system is Nei Chia rather than Taiji Quan.
